ABSTRACT
This study tries to present the socio-economic scenario of child labor in Bangladesh which
has in recent times attracted concerted attention not only in Bangladesh but also all over the
globe. Indeed, child labor is recognized as a considerable part of the existing market and by
the present write-up this statement has been upheld through a number of case studies. There
is no question regarding the indispensability of elimination of child labor from the social but
question arises whether it would bring good foray particular society such as Bangladesh.
Child labor problem is a socio-economic reality in the country which cannot be ignored;
hence steps have to be taken. At first to decrease child labor rather removing it diametrically
from the society. Itshould be remembered that if child labor was given out just now from the
country, then that would jeopardize the child laborers who earn their own bread or for the
families who depend on the child workers. This article attempts to search out the ways how
child labor can be decreased gradually and at the end of the paper these ways have been
presented as suggestions or recommendation.
